大数据之Linux01

大数据分布式存储:HDFS
大数据分布式运算:MR
Linux的特点:安全性高,稳定性好,有文件系统,多用户权限控制严格,占用资源少,开源免费,没有桌面,方便部署
Linux基础命令:
cd / 进入根目录
cd ./文件夹名 进入当前目录某个文件夹
cd …/ 返回上级目录
/ 表示绝对路径,每次都是从根目录开始
./ 和 …/ 表示相对路径.表示当前目录或当前目录的上级目录
ls 文件夹 查看指定文件夹下的文件名
ls -a 可显示隐藏文件名
ls -l 显示目录下详细信息
ll 同ls -l
pwd 展示当前所在的目录
reboot 重启
ls /bin | grep 1 从bin目录下搜索含有1的文件名
useradd root1 添加一个用户root1 可在/home下查看
su root1 切换用户为root1

mkdir 文件夹名 创建一个文件夹
mkdir -p /a/b/c/ 创建多个文件夹
touch 1.txt 创建一个文件
touch /a/b/1.txt 在b目录下创建一个文件
mv /a/1.txt /b/2/txt 移动文件并会改名
cp /a/1.txt /b/2/txt 复制文件并改名
cp -r /a/ /b/ 复制非空文件夹需加上-r
rm -rf /a/ 删除文件/文件夹
rm *.txt 删除以.txt结尾的文件
rm * 删除当前文件夹下所有文件

vi 文件名 进入文件编辑的命令模式
i 进入编辑模式
o 换行进入编辑模式
A 从当前行的行末进入编辑模式
:qw! 保存并退出

在命令模式下
ZZ 保存并退出
dd 剪切当前行
10dd 剪切10行
yy 复制当前行
10yy 从当前行复制10行
p 粘贴上次复制或剪切的信息
u 撤销上一次操作
set nu 显示行号
set nonu 隐藏行号
nG 跳转到第n行开始查看
G 跳转最后一行
gg 跳转到第一行
/uid 在文件内容里搜索uid

cat 文件名 查看文件内容

less 查看大文件时使用
空格 下一页
b 上一页
j 下一行
s 下一行
q 退出查看

head 从文件头查看
head -10 文件名 查看前10行

tail 从文件尾查看
tail -10 文件名 查看尾10行

echo “hello” 打印到控制台
echo “hello” > 1.txt 写入到1.txt文件中,重复写入会覆盖原数据
echo “hello” >> 1.txt 追加写入

Ctrl+z 将正在运行的程序挂到后台,并暂停运行
jobs 查看挂在后台的目录
fg 1 进入1号后台文件

设置IP
vi /etc/sysconfig/network-scripts/ifcfg-ens33

IPADDR=192.168.128.204 //本机ip
NETMASK=255.255.255.0 //子网掩码
GATENAT=192.168.128.1 //虚拟网络ip
DNS1=192.168.128.1

service network restart 重启网络

systemctl status firewalld 查看防火墙状态
systemctl disable firewalld 关闭防火墙

  • 1
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值